Analysis

The most recent figure for uruguay —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in Spain is 2,759 1000 USD, measured in 2018.

The figure is up 3.7% on the previous year and up 69.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, uruguay —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in Spain peaked at 3,329 1000 USD in 2011 and was at its lowest, 639 1000 USD, in 2015.

Spain ranks 7th of 38 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
